Rails of the World: Paintings by J. Fenwick Lansdowne

March 17, 1977 – May 1, 1977

Enjoy 42 framed watercolors by Canadian artist/naturalist Lansdowne, which illustrate Secretary Ripley's forthcoming bird book, "Rails of the World." 

After its inaugural showing here, the SITES exhibition will go on tour.
